Welcome to the Unofficial BOINC Wiki!

BOINC is an open source software platform to allow distributed computing projects like SETI@Home and Climateprediction.net (CPDN) which use volunteered computer resources to run. Why leave a computer idle when it could be doing something beneficial?

Now you can participate in scientific research! If you own a computer (Microsoft Windows®, Apple Mac OS X, Linux or Unix) install the BOINC Client Software and you can help scientific research projects in many areas of science and for university research projects located all over the world.

This Wiki is designed to be a central repository for information about the BOINC System and BOINC Powered Projects. This covers all levels information from help for a novice Participant wanting to get started, to developers for a BOINC Powered Project, and even the BOINC Developers. With lots of disparate websites for all of the varied aspects of the BOINC System and the BOINC Powered Projects, information can get spread around and there can be cases of different versions of the same information that are each out of date to different extents. Bringing all the information together makes linking and keeping information updated much easier and helps reduce the workload for time stressed project developers. Therefore, it is an aim to get everyone involved with the BOINC System to use this Wiki as much as possible for documentation in place of their individual websites.
